A major renovation to the Babbitt Ice Arena is one step closer to reality thanks to legislation authored by Senator Grant Hauschild (DFL – Hermantown). The $1.5 million investment was secured through Hauschild’s Mineral Article in the 2024 Tax Omnibus bill passed last year. It was approved by the full Iron Range Resources and Rehabilitation Advisory Board as part of the $68.3 million budget.

In the 2024 Session, Hauschild chief authored the minerals article of the tax bill, which delivered property tax relief and targeted capital investments in the region. This included a 65% increase in the taconite homestead credit equal to $515 per year for every homestead in the Taconite Relief Area (TRA) and $80 million in targeted bonding authority, with oversight by the IRRRB.
